🔑 Car Key & Fob FAQ

Common questions about key programming, fob issues, and replacement options

Key Programming
Common reasons: wrong key type for your vehicle, anti-theft system needs reset, low car battery voltage during programming, or the key isn't properly synced. Some cars also have programming limits (only 2-4 keys can be registered).
Key Fob Issues
1) Find the seam and pry open the fob (some have tiny screws) 2) Note battery orientation 3) Remove old battery (CR2032 is most common) 4) Insert new battery 5) Reassemble. Test all buttons - if issues remain, the fob may need reprogramming.
Lost Keys
Locksmiths or dealers can: 1) Decode your door or ignition lock to determine key cuts 2) Access your car's key code through manufacturer databases (with proof of ownership) 3) Program new transponder keys using diagnostic equipment.
Security Systems
This means your car's immobilizer system can't read the key's transponder. Causes: dead key battery, damaged transponder chip, faulty car antenna ring around ignition, or system needs resetting. Try replacing the battery first.
Lost Keys
Costs vary widely: Basic keys: $50-$150, Transponder keys: $150-$300, Smart keys/fobs: $200-$800, Dealership replacements typically cost 20-50% more than locksmiths. Emergency/lockout service adds $50-$150.
Key Fact: Key fob batteries typically last 3-4 years with normal use
